Huỳnh Minh Hưng, commonly known by his stage name Đàm Vĩnh Hưng (born 2 October 1971), often referred to by his nickname Mr. Dam, is a Vietnamese singer. He won 2 Dedication awards and multiple awards in Vietnam. Besides V-pop, he also performed many pre-war songs, Trinh Cong Son's songs and yellow music. He is one of the most highly paid singers in Vietnam and some of his alleged statements have appeared in tabloids.

He won The Most Excellent Singer prize in the contest which was held by Ben Thanh Theater's Young Audience Music Club from September 2000 – September 2001. This is considered to be the milestone of his career. His two songs ''Tình Ơi Xin Ngủ Yên'' (Please sleep tight my love) and ''Bình Minh Sẽ Mang Em Đi'' (The sunrise will take you away), which were well-known and widely recognizable, became a remarkable milestone of his music career. At the beginning of his career, his unique raspy voice resembles Vietnamese-American singer Don Ho, and he often sang with very strong intonation at the end of each lyrics. Afterward, he chose to sing pre-war songs, romance songs and yellow music. Controversies


Wrong songs

In his Vol. 8 album, ''Tình Ca Hoài Niệm'' (also known as ''Tình Ca 50'') including love songs from 1954 to 1975, ''Phố Đêm'' (Night Town) was also one of the chosen songs in the album, on the cover it was said to be one of Nguyen Tuan Kiet's songs, however the song in the album was another song with same title from songwriter Tam Anh, that song was banned due to be thought as songs from old regime before 1975. He explained that he had badly misunderstood, but still got 30 million Vietnam Dong fine, the production company was fined 23 million Vietnamdong and the album was withdrawn from the shelf. In the album Mr. Dam (2005), the song '' Em Đã Quên Một Dòng Sông'' was printed on the cover to be allegedly composed by songwriter Hai Trieu, actually this is a song by Vietnamese-American songwriter Truc Ho without his permission. Thuy Nga Center was the official representative for the release of this album, but ''Em Đã Quên Một Dòng Sông'' was cut out. Also in this album, ''Bạc Tình'' was a song by Vietnamese-American songwriter Huynh Nhat Tan, but it was printed to belong to songwriter Nhat Dang Khoa on the cover.

Attack in America (2010)

On July 18, 2010, he was attacked by Lý Tống while performing at Santa Clara Conference Center in Santa Clara, California, USA. Middle-aged and older individuals didn't approve of his appearance at the music show and there were protests. There were plans put out to pressure the organizers to cancel any show with Dam Vinh Hung involved. According to the Mercury News, many supported Lý Tống, including local politicians and demanded his immediate release. Lý Buồi hoped that the jury wouldn't accuse him of having violent intention, based on his excuse as he "protected Vietnamese community from the representative of the Communist regime". However, he was still found guilty and had to serve 6 months in jail and another 3 years under control. The incident was heavily protested by Vietnamese Community in the US due to viewing Đàm Vĩnh Hưng as someone who propagandizes the Government of Vietnam. He was previously honored by the Government of Vietnam for performing multiple political songs while waving Vietnam's national flag which Vietnamese-Americans bristle at. Moreover, his comment to Lý Buồi, "I'm willing to forgive" was considered provocative.

Kissing a monk in 2012

During the auction as a contribution for charity foundation for Wanbi Tuan Anh at Khong Ten Music Tearoom on 4 November 2012, he brought a bottle of wine on stage for auctioning along the declaration: "The winner will bring the bottle of wine home and my two kisses". As the result, the winner was two monks for auctioning the bottle of wine for 55 million Vietnamdong. Afterward, he kissed one of the two monks on the lips and kissed the hand of the older monk. The monks were later fined from the higher monks for 3 months under control. The younger monk who kissed Dam Vinh Hung on the lip later deconsecrated due to family circumstance and his will was accepted. In the letter to the press on 9 November, Dam Vinh Hung sent an apology to the audiences and monks. On 14 November 2012, the inspector of Vietnam's bureau of culture, sport and tourism invited him to Ha Noi for reporting, then fined him for 5 million Vietnam Dong for hi previous action toward the monk which was considered to be offensive. Later, another letter from Dam Vinh Hung allegedly, he revealed that the monk was the one who wanted to do the kiss and some negative accusations about this monk. However, after deconsecration, the monk stated that Dam Vinh Hung was the one who ignited it and denied all the false accusations from Dam Vinh Hung.

The incident at General Vo Nguyen Giap's funeral

On 6 October 2013, instead of queuing to visit General Vo Nguyen Giap's funeral, he and his assistant entered the funeral zone without queuing like others. He got the privilege to visit first in the surprise of many military veterans and Vietnam citizens. Answering the journalist of Dat Viet Newspaper, the security guard at the funeral said that: "Before the visit, he had already called for permission".
